hsa-miR-206b Involves in the Development of Papillary Thyroid Carcinoma via Targeting LMX1B
Figure 5
LMX1B was a target gene of hsa-miR-206. (a) The LMX1B expression level was decreased and the hsa-miR-206 expression level was increased in the stage III_IV group () compared with the stage I_II group () based on TCGA data. Boxes represented the interquartile range of the data, and the lines across the boxes indicated the median values. The hash marks above and below the boxes indicated the 90th and 10th percentiles for each group, respectively. values were calculated by the Wilcoxon rank sum test. (b) The LMX1B expression level and hsa-miR-206 expression level were analyzed in the stage I and stage II patients based on qPCR data. Boxes represented the interquartile range of the data, and the lines across the boxes indicated the median values. The hash marks above and below the boxes indicated the 90th and 10th percentiles for each group, respectively. values were calculated by the Wilcoxon rank sum test. (c) A significant inverse correlation was observed between the LMX1B and hsa-miR-206 expression levels in the PTC tissue samples () by Pearson’s correlation () based on qPCR data. (d) Based on line regression, a negative correlation between the LMX1B expression levels and MACIS scores and a positive correlation between the hsa-miR-206 expression levels and MACIS scores were observed. (e) Predicted interaction between hsa-miR-206 and the putative binding sites in the LMX1B 3-UTR based on miRanda. hsa-miR-206 seed sequence was shown in bold. The representation was limited to the region around the hsa-miR-206 complementary site. The number of the binding site was 1959-1981.
